Bendigo, Victoria More Info
With restored Victorian-era architecture dating back to the "Gold Rush" Bendigo is abundant with sandstone buildings, 100 year old gardens and large shade trees. The first thing you notice is the tree lined streets and amazing buildings leading you to the central Alexandra Fountain. Trams still operate in Bendigo and you won't want to miss out on a "talking tram tour".

Hotel and Motel Accommodation More Info
Hotel and Motel Accommodation offers the most frequented accommodation by holiday makers and business people alike. Both Hotels and Motels offer a range from budget the 5 star luxury rooms. A Motel is considered to have parking provided near the room with the room door exits to the parking lot. Both a Hotel and a Motel are usually serviced, most with full ensuite but not full cooking facilities.
